Bloomfield won the last time they faced Shiprock, and Xavier Abernathy did his part to make sure it happened again. The Bloomfield Bobcats came out on top against the Shiprock Chieftains by a score of 59-48 on Saturday thanks in part to Abernathy, who dropped a double-double on 22 points and 14 boards. The dominant performance also gave him a new career-high in blocks (three).
Despite the loss, Shiprock saw an underclassman step up: sophomore Elishah Tsosie posted 20 points. That was a full 41.7% of Shiprock's points, marking the third time in a row he's had more than a third of the team's points. Tyler Jim was another key player, putting up seven points.
Bloomfield moved to 7-9 with that victory, which also ended their four-game losing streak. As for Shiprock, they are on a 14-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 2-14.
